This video is an answer to a couple of questions I have received about the difference between Array Copying Vectors vs Array Copying Toolpaths in Vectric Cut2D Desktop, Cut2D Pro, VCarve Desktop, VCarve Pro, and Aspire.
In this video, I’ll first demonstrate creating an array copy of two 2D vectors, then demonstrate the Array Copy Toolpaths function with those same vectors to drill the holes for threaded inserts for a spoilboard.
Then I’ll show you how to use the Array Copy Toolpaths option to machine an array of four 3D components from one single component and 2 vectors.

@MarkLindsayCNC
@MarkLindsayCNC 3 года назад
Thank you, Steve. Both good questions. 1.) No, the software doesn't automatically recognize potential collisions. That's why it's important to keep the tool diameter in mind while designing, Preview the toolpaths, make any adjustments that are needed, then Preview again if needed. 2.) The short answer is No, only because Start Depth and Cut Depth aren't variables that are built into the calculators. Having said that, one of the presentations during this year's (or maybe it was last year's) Vectric Worldwide Users Group Meeting had a segment on adding certain variables to the calculators. I'll try to find that presentation, and do a little bit of experimenting on my own. If I succeed, I'll certainly do a video on it.

@MarkLindsayCNC
@MarkLindsayCNC 2 года назад
Please remember that this tutorial was meant to demonstrate how to array copy toolpaths only. That's why I never got into machining times in this video. There are a lot of variables involved in carve times. To help reduce carve times, check the Feed Rate and Plunge Rate you have entered for each of the bits you're going to use (using the EDIT button within the toolpath.) The thing to remember is that the CNC will always move at the rate of the slowest axis. In 3D carving, that's almost always the Z axis, because the Z is in almost constant motion. So you can have a feed rate of 200 inches per minute, but if your plunge rate is 30 inches per minute, that how fast the CNC is going to carve. That's why I use a Roughing toolpath - to remove most of the material, with a .030 machining allowance. With about .030 left to machine in the Finishing toolpath, I can set that plunge rate to the same as my feed rate. That single action will give you a huge reduction in machining time.
